Process plugin files.

Usage: plugin install PLUGIN-FILE [forced]
  install a plugin

  PLUGIN-FILE is a plugin definition XML file with ".plg" extension.

  PLUGIN-FILE can be a local file, or a URL.  If a URL, the plugin file is first downloaded to /tmp/plugins.

  forced is optional and can be used to install a lower version than currently running.

  This command has two major use cases:

  1) Invoked at system startup by /etc/rc.d/rc.local on each .plg file found int /boot/config/plugins.

     Upon success we register the plugin as "installed" by creating a symlink to it in /var/log/plugins.

     If any kind of error, we move the file to /boot/config/plugins-error.

     If a symlink already exists for the plugin file, this indicates a plugin replacing a "built-in" plugin.  In
     this case, if the version of PLUGIN-FILE is newer than the built-in plugin, we go ahead and install normally;
     otherwise, we move to /boot/config/plugins-stale.

  2) Invoked manually or via Plugin Manager for a .plg file not in /boot/config/plugins.

     If a symlink already exists for the plugin file, this indicates a plugin update. In this case, if the version of
     PLUGIN-FILE is newer than the built-in plugin, we go ahead and install normally and then move the old plugin
     to /boot/config/plugins-stale.

     Upon success we copy PLUGIN-FILE to /boot/config/plugins and register it as "installed" by creating a
     symlink to it in /var/log/plugins.

Usage: plugin remove PLUGIN
  remove a plugin

  PLUGIN is the file basename of a plugin, e.g., "myplugin.plg".

  If PLUGIN is found in /var/log/plugins then this command will process all FILE elements in PLUGIN which are
  tagged with the "remove" method.  Upon success we delete /var/log/plugins/PLUGIN and move the plugin
  file to /boot/config/plugins-removed

Usage: plugin check PLUGIN
  check and output the latest version of PLUGIN

  We extract the pluginURL attribute from PLUGIN and use it to download (presumably the latest
  version of) the plugin file to /tmp/plugins/ directory, and then output the version string.

Usage: plugin checkall
  check all installed plugins

  Runs 'plugin check PLUGIN' for each plugin file linked-to in /var/log/plugins.

Usage: plugin update PLUGIN
  update the plugin

  We look for the new plugin in /tmp/plugins/ directory.  If found then we first execute the "install"
  method of each FILE in the new plugin.  (If necessary, a plugin can detect that this is an
  "update" by checking for the existence of /var/log/plugins/PLUGIN.)  If successful, we
  delete the "old" plugin file from /boot/config/plugins/, copy the "new" plugin file from
  /tmp/plugins/ to /boot/config/plugins/, and finally create the new symlink.

  Note: to support `plugin check` and `plugin update` the plugin file must contain both "pluginURL" and
  "version" attributes.

Usage: plugin download PLUGIN-FILE [TARGET-VERSION] [forced]
  Downloads plugin files without executing any Run commands defined for the install method.
  This method first updates the plugin definition file (.plg) to the latest version, then
  downloads all required files but skips script execution. This makes it suitable for
  preparing plugin files before an Unraid OS upgrade.

  TARGET-VERSION is optional and specifies the Unraid version to use for version compatibility
  checks (Min/Max attributes). If omitted, the current Unraid version is used.

Usage: plugin [attribute name] PLUGIN-FILE

Any method which is not one of the actions listed above is assumed to be the name of an attribute of
the <PLUGIN> tag within PLUGIN-FILE.  If the attribute exists, its value (a string) is output and the command
exit status is 0.  If the attribute does not exist, command exit status is 1.

The plugin manager recognizes this set of attributes for the <PLUGIN> tag:

name - MANDATORY plugin name, e.g., "myplugin" or "my-plugin" etc.
  This tag defines the name of the plugin.  The name should omit embedded information such as architecture,
  version, author, etc.

  The plugin should create a directory under `/usr/local/emhttp/plugins` named after
  the plugin, e.g., `/usr/local/emhttp/plugins/myplugin`.  Any webGui pages, icons, README files, etc, should
  be created inside this directory.

  The plugin should also create a directory under `/boot/config/plugins` named after the plugin, e.g.,
  `/boot/config/plugins/myplugin`.  Here is where you store plugin-specific files such as a configuration
  file and icon file.  Note that this directory exists on the users USB Flash device and writes should be
  minimized.

  Upon successful installation, the plugin manager will copy the input plugin file to `/boot/config/plugins`
  on the users USB Flash device, and create a symlink in `/var/log/plugins` also named after the plugin,
  e.g., `/var/log/plugins/myplugin`.  Each time the unRaid server is re-booted, all plugins stored
  in `/boot/config/plugins` are automatically installed; plugin authors should be aware of this behavior.

author - OPTIONAL
  Whatever you put here will show up under the **Author** column in the Plugin List.  If this attribute
  is omitted we display "anonymous".

version - MANDATORY
  Use a string suitable for comparison to determine if one version is older/same/newer than another version.
  Any format is acceptable but LimeTech uses "YYYY.MM.DD", e.g., "2014.02.18" (if multiple versions happen
  to get posted on the same day we add a letter suffix, e.g., "2014.02.18a").

pluginURL - OPTIONAL but MANDATORY if you want "check for updates" to work with your plugin
  This is the URL of the plugin file to download and extract the **version** attribute from to determine if
  this is a new version.

More attributes may be defined in the future.

Here is the set of directories and files used by the plugin system:

/boot/config/plugins/
  This directory contains the plugin files for plugins to be (re)installed at boot-time. Upon
  successful `plugin install`, the plugin file is copied here (if not here already).  Upon successful
  `plugin remove`, the plugin file is deleted from here.

/boot/config/plugins-error/
  This directory contains plugin files that failed to install.

/boot/config/plugins-removed/
  This directory contains plugin files that have been removed.

/boot/config/plugins-stale/
  This directory contains plugin files that failed to install because a newer version of the same plugin is
  already installed.

/tmp/plugins/
  This directory is used as a target for downloaded plugin files.  The `plugin check` operation
  downloads the plugin file here and the `plugin update` operation looks for the plugin to update here.

/var/log/plugins/
  This directory contains a symlink named after the plugin name (not the plugin file name) which points to
  the actual plugin file used to install the plugin.  The existence of this file indicates successful
  install of the plugin.
